The Mayo Clinic Critical and Neurocritical Care Board Review 2nd edition offers the latest updates from The Neurocritical Care Board Examination, uniquely combining general intensive care with neurocritical care. This comprehensive volume, authored by experienced consultants in neurointensive and medical intensive care, is the first to integrate both fields into a single resource.

Aligned with the key disorders outlined by the UCNS and the American Board of Medical Specialties, this book ensures thorough preparation for the examination. Each chapter delves into basic pathophysiology, major disorders, syndromes, and their management. Given the significant focus on neurology in critical illness and acute brain injury, this book is also an invaluable tool for those preparing for the Critical Care Medicine boards.

Recommended for intensivists, neurointensivists, and fellows in these specialties, this book is an essential resource for mastering the complexities of neurocritical care.

This book provides a comprehensive review of critical care medicine to assist in preparation of the neurocritical care and general critical care boards.
Eelco Wijdicks is Professor of Neurology, Mayo Clinic College of Medicine, Chair of the Division of Critical Care Neurology, and Consultant, Neurological Neurosurgical Intensive Care Unit, Saint Marys Hospital, Mayo Clinic, USA.
